What is the nearest hospital to Barnsdall Nursing Home? + −
Ascension St. John Jane Phillips (formerly Jane Phillips Medical Center) in Bartlesville, approximately 20 miles east of Barnsdall, is the nearest full-service hospital. It provides emergency care, surgical services, and a broad range of specialty care for the Osage County region.
What is Barnsdall, Oklahoma like for seniors? + −
Barnsdall is a small, peaceful community in the Osage Hills of northeastern Oklahoma with a strong sense of community and rich oil-boom heritage. Osage Hills State Park is nearby for scenic recreation, and the larger city of Bartlesville — with full retail, dining, and medical services — is just a short drive away.
